This form is an Assignment of a Copyright. The assignor transfers to the assignee all of the assignor's rights, title, and interest to the copyright secured by the assignor for the original work described in the form.

Pennsylvania Assignment of Copyright is a legal document that allows the transfer of ownership or rights from the copyright holder (assignor) to another person or entity (assignee) within the state of Pennsylvania. This assignment provides legal protection to the intellectual property (IP) and allows the assignee to exploit, utilize, and enforce the copyright. This legal document ensures that the assignee becomes the rightful owner of the copyright and can exercise all related rights as authorized by law. The assignment agreement typically includes details such as the names and addresses of the parties involved (assignor and assignee), a description of the copyrighted work, effective date of transfer, specific rights being assigned, and any conditions or limitations associated with the assignment. It is crucial for both parties to clearly understand and agree upon these terms to prevent any disputes in the future. The assignment of copyright grants the assignee the exclusive right to reproduce, distribute, display, perform, and create derivative works based on the copyrighted material. It also provides the assignee with the ability to enforce the copyright, pursue legal action against infringement, and collect damages for any unauthorized use. The main difference between assignment of rights and a license is ownership. An assignment permanently transfers copyright ownership to another party, while a license grants permission to use the work without changing ownership. This distinction is vital for creators as it affects how they control their works. An assignment of copyright is a legal transfer of ownership of a work from one party to another. This process allows the assignee to exercise rights such as reproduction, distribution, and adaptation of the work.
